conceal in Japanese

conceal in Japanese is 隠す — conceal means to hide something from sight or keep it secret from others.

conceal in Japanese

隠す
verb
Pronounced: kakusu
(transitive) To hide something from view or from public knowledge, to try to keep something secret.

What does "conceal" mean?

  1. verb To hide something from sight or keep it secret from others.
    "He tried to conceal his nervousness during the interview."

conceal in a sentence

  • He tried to conceal his nervousness during the interview.
  • The smugglers concealed the goods inside hollowed-out furniture.
